Fire Snake (54th term of the sexagenary cycle)
Refers to the 54th term of the traditional 60-term sexagenary cycle, combining the celestial stem 丁 (Fire, yin) and the earthly branch 巳 (Snake). Used in East Asian calendars and astrology.

1917年は丁巳の年です。
The year 1917 is the year of the Fire Snake.
丁巳の日は、暦の上で特別な意味を持つことがあります。
The day of the Fire Snake sometimes holds special significance in the calendar.
干支 is the general term for the sexagenary cycle or Chinese zodiac; 丁巳 is one specific term within that cycle.
From the combination of the celestial stem 丁 (ひのと, 'Fire, yin') and the earthly branch 巳 (み, 'Snake'), forming the 54th term of the sexagenary cycle.
